DAPBI halts Teijin Aramid program

October 28th, 2015

Dutch high-tech fiber developer Teijin Aramid has announced it is stopping its research program that would develop and commercialize aramid copolymers containing DAPBI. The prototype materials demonstrated good antiballistic performance, but use of the substance could be dangerous to people involved in the production of the monomer and copolymer. Teijin begins production of Teijinconex® neo

September 4th, 2015

Bangkok-based Teijin Corp. (Thailand) Ltd. has begun producing Teijinconex® neo, a new heat-resistant and dyeable meta-aramid fiber, at its premises in Ayutthaya, Thailand. Teijinconex neo’s heat resistance and dyeability offers solutions for the design and manufacture of protective apparel.
